On-task/Off-task (Attention) Observation forms

Created by
Nichole Freeman
On/Off-task Observation form Use to take data on kids with attention difficulties. Each page is a 10-minute observation, separated into 15 second intervals (40 intervals total for 10 minutes) and includes a line for comparison peer data. After observing, add up the the number of intervals in which the student was on and off-task, and divide by 40 (or 80 if you do two pages for 20 minutes of observation).
